Transaction 269a51e28c8663b80701d94d2726faf86566afa826d4a37ea4ca10b177441263

4 Input
2 Outputs
  • 269a51e28c8663b80701d94d2726faf86566afa826d4a37ea4ca10b177441263:0
  • value  13090
    address  2NFmpz3MjvV4pUUSx5i7iDBxxZESpSveAue
  • 269a51e28c8663b80701d94d2726faf86566afa826d4a37ea4ca10b177441263:1
  • value  878872
    address  mwsEzaxoKkyUU3DbNtVfUmmoM7owUeSJ2F